Ninth Circuit Allows Whistleblowers Case to Proceed in Bid-Rigging Case

A qui tam lawsuit will be permitted to proceed in the Ninth Circuit after whistleblowers filed a state complaint and then subsequently filed a federal qui tam action.  The Ninth Circuit Court of Appeals reversed a lower court holding and ruled that the only notice needed for qualification as an original source is that the information be provided to the government prior to the filing of the action.
